Bio
Career
*Member of Drexel’s 2021 Colonial Athletic Association championship team
*One of two Drexel men’s basketball players to win the prestigious CAA Dean Ehlers Award
*Played in 107 games in his career and had 90 steals
*Career .772 shooter from the free throw line
*Graduated with a degree in biological sciences
*Dean’s List student every semester at Drexel
2021-22 / Senior
Appeared in all 29 games during his final season…received the team’s Academic Award and for the fourth straight season…scored seven points and had three rebounds off the bench in the win at James Madison…averaged 2.2 points in just under 15 minutes of playing time per game…named to the CAA Commissioner’s Academic Honor Roll once again…was a two-year member of the Dragon Leadership Academy, which helps build student-athlete leaders at the school.
2020-21 / Junior
Played in all 20 games…selected as the Drexel “D” Award and Academic Award winner for an unprecedented third-straight year…averaged 3.8 points and 2.1 rebounds…led the team with 19 steals…tied a career-high with five assists at Pittsburgh and added a season-best three steals…averaged 6.3 points in the three games in the CAA Championships…shot just under 82 percent from the line…ended the season by making his last 16 free throws…named to the CAA Commissioner’s Academic Honor Roll…had multiple stories published in CardioSmart, the patient engagement program of the American College of Cardiology.
2019-20 / Sophomore
Started 15 times and appeared in all 33 games in his second season…was second on the team and 15th in the CAA in steals per game…earned both the Drexel “D” Award and the team’s Academic Award for the second-straight season…averaged 5.2 points per game and shot .746 from the line…made 27 of his 79 3-point attempts (.342)…finished third on the team with 65 assists…opened the year with 11 points and three 3-pointers at Temple…had a career-high 16 points against Rosemont…scored 13 points on 5-for-8 shooting…recorded 10 points or more five times…picked up two or more steals in nine of the first 10 games…named to the CAA Commissioner’s Academic Honor Roll.
2018-19 / Freshman
Played in 25 games as a first-year player…started three of the last four games…scored a season-high 11 points on 5-for-7 shooting in the CAA quarterfinals against the College of Charleston…played 36 minutes in that game and tied a Drexel CAA Championship record with five steals…handed out five assists against Northeastern…given the Dragon "D" Award as the team's top defender…finished the year averaging 1.6 points…named to the CAA Commissioner’s Academic Honor Roll and also was the team’s Academic Award recipient.
Background
Graduated from Lake Forest Academy in Lake Forest, Ill., just north of Chicago, for two years…averaged 12.3 points, 5.5 rebounds and 3.6 assists in his final season…a First Team All-Area selection by North Shore…an Honor Roll student throughout high school…also a Dean’s List student…ran track and was a sprinter…attended Oakwood Collegiate Institute in his hometown of Toronto before transferring to Lake Forest.
Personal
Son of Branimir and Dragica Juric...has one brother.
